Comprehending Eco-Friendly Copy Paper
Environment-friendly copy paper is made from sustainable materials and processes that minimize harm to the environment. Unlike traditional paper production, which can include deforestation and chemical treatments, environment-friendly alternatives are created to be less resource-intensive and more sustainable.

Kinds Of Eco-Friendly Copy Paper
Recycled Paper: Made from post-consumer waste, recycled paper is one of the most typical types of environment-friendly paper. It saves trees and uses less energy and water compared to producing brand-new paper.
Bamboo Paper: Bamboo is a fast-growing plant that can be gathered sustainably. Bamboo paper is not only environmentally friendly but likewise strong and resilient, making it perfect for various printing requirements.
Sugarcane Paper: After processing sugarcane for its juice, the remaining pulp can be made into paper. This technique makes use of biomass that would otherwise be waste, providing an excellent alternative to wood-based paper.
Hemp Paper: Hemp has a fast development rate and needs less resources than traditional trees. Hemp paper is known for its sturdiness and can be recycled multiple times.

How to Choose the Right Eco-Friendly Copy Paper for Your Needs
Selecting the best type of environmentally friendly copy paper can depend on several factors, consisting of printing needs, budget plan, and ecological objectives. Here are some factors to consider:
1. Assess Your Printing Needs
- What type of printing will you be doing? (color vs. black and white?)
- Will the paper be utilized for everyday printing or unique tasks?
2. Inspect Certifications
- Search for respectable certifications such as FSC, SFI, or comparable eco-labels that show sustainable sourcing.
3. Think About Weight and Thickness
- Various weights (determined in grams per square meter or GSM) and density can affect the quality and feel of the printed material.
4. Compatibility with Equipment
- Validate the compatibility of the environment-friendly paper with your printers or copiers to make sure smooth operation.
5. Examine Your Budget
- Consider your print frequency and volume to evaluate whether the slightly greater cost of environment-friendly paper fits within your budget.
